A beginner's overview of the art of customizing plastic factory-produced model horses, such as Breyer, and Stone.
| This "primer" on customizing (remaking) model horses contains concise, useful information to familiarize yourself with the processes, tools and materials typically used to transform a factory model out of the box into your own custom creation. | ||
|
Customizing the Model Horse includes recommendations of tools, filler and sculpting materials, as well as a step-by-step overview of the procedures required to take a model from start to finish. It includes basic information on techniques for repositioning limbs, resculpting areas, painting and adding lifelike hair to a model. Safety precautions are also covered. 14 pages, illustrated by Carol Williams |
